Please tell us about your submission (maximum 600 words)

Amatonormativity, as you will soon read about in my piece, is the idea that the ideal life involves two people married with kids. I try my best to show all of the flaws in that idea using my writing, as well as show the harmful environment it creates. As someone who is asexual and on the aromantic spectrum, I have to deal with amatonormativity every day. By submitting this piece, I hope to let the world know what I, and others like me, have to learn to live with.

What is something you learned about patriarchy and what is something you would like to change about what you learned?

I learned that the patriarchy has a much wider influence than you would initially think. The idea of the atomic family is the symbol of the patriarchy, and those ideas have spread into every part of our life. The belief in amatonormativity, that the ideal life is two people married with kids, is why there is such strong bias against asexual and aromantic people. I would like to change the idea that in order to be happy, you have to be married with kids. It's absurd that you need someone else to be happy, that you can't enjoy life on your own. It is another symbol of the patriachy's widespread issues, and it needs to change.
